A fellow inmate conspired to traffic drugs, and they ended up back in prison together.

September 15, 2016 16:00

(Baonghean.vn) - Having known each other in prison, Binh conspired with Oanh to buy methamphetamine from Hanoi and sell it in Nghe An for profit. As a result, both Oanh and Binh returned to prison with the charge of "Illegal trafficking of narcotics".

On September 15th, the Provincial People's Court held a first-instance criminal trial to hear the case against Nham Thi Binh (born in 1972), residing in Vinh Quang Hamlet, Dong Vinh Ward, Vinh City, and Dinh Thi Kim Oanh (born in 1963), residing in Ngoc Hoi Commune, Thanh Tri District, Hanoi, for the crime of "illegally trading narcotics".

The two defendants, Oanh and Bình, stand before the horseshoe-shaped dock.

In 2003, Nham Thi Binh was sentenced to 15 years in prison by the Nghe An Provincial People's Court for "illegally trading narcotics." In 2013, Binh was released early. Meanwhile, Dinh Thi Kim Oanh also has a long criminal record. In 1996, Oanh was sentenced to 3 years in prison by the Hanoi City People's Court for "harboring prostitution." In 2000, the Hanoi City People's Court sentenced Oanh to 7 years and 6 months in prison for "illegally trading narcotics." Then, in 2008, Dinh Thi Kim Oanh was again sentenced to 8 years in prison by the Hoan Kiem District People's Court (Hanoi) for "illegally possessing narcotics."

During their time serving their sentences, Oanh and Binh became acquainted because they were in the same prison camp. After their release, they maintained contact. On April 13, 2016, Nham Thi Binh called Oanh, asking her to bring 500 grams of methamphetamine to Vinh City for sale, at an agreed price of 35 million VND per 100 grams. After purchasing the drugs, on the morning of April 14, 2016, Oanh took a taxi from Hanoi to Nghe An to visit Binh's house.

When the taxi carrying Oanh arrived at the Hoang Mai toll station (in Quynh Thien ward, Hoang Mai town), police discovered and apprehended Dinh Thi Kim Oanh along with 5 packets of methamphetamine. Based on Oanh's confession, the investigating agency arrested Nham Thi Binh. The forensic examination by the Criminal Technical Department of the Nghe An Provincial Police concluded that the aforementioned methamphetamine was indeed methamphetamine, weighing 496.55g.

At the trial, the defendants admitted their crimes. The representative of the Provincial People's Procuracy stated that the defendants' actions constituted dangerous recidivism, requiring a severe sentence to serve as a deterrent. They requested the court to sentence Nham Thi Binh to 14 to 14 years and 6 months in prison, and Dinh Thi Kim Oanh to 16 to 17 years in prison.

The defense lawyer for Nham Thi Binh requested the court to consider mitigating circumstances, arguing that the defendant's crime was not completed and she did not profit illegally from the drug trafficking.

The panel of judges concluded, based on public questioning at the trial, the investigation findings, arguments, and opinions of the prosecutor and defense lawyers, that there is sufficient basis to affirm that the defendants' actions constitute the crime of illegal trafficking of narcotics. The two defendants are responsible for 311g of pure narcotics, committing the crime as dangerous recidivism and infringing upon the State's exclusive right to manage narcotics…

After a comprehensive review of the case and the aggravating and mitigating circumstances, the panel of judges sentenced Dinh Thi Kim Oanh to 18 years in prison and Nham Thi Binh to 15 years in prison for the aforementioned crime.
